MySQL—创建数据表
一、认识数据表
表(Table)是数据库中数据存储最常见和最简单的一种形式,数据库可以将复杂的数据结构用较为简单的二维表来表示。二维表是由行和列组成的,分别都包含着数据,如表所示。
每个表都是由若干行和列组成的,在数据库中表中的行被称为记录,表中的列被称为是这些记录的字段。
记录也被称为一行数据,是表里的一行。在关系型数据库的表里,一行数据是指一条完整的记录。
二、创建数据库表t_student
需求:
建立一张用来存储学生信息的表
字段包含学号、姓名、性别,年龄、入学日期、班级,email等信息
学号是主键 = 不能为空 + 唯一
姓名不能为空
性别默认值是男
Email唯一
1、创建数据库,mytestdb就是数据库
2、查询——新建查询
3、创建数据库表
创建数据库表:create table 数据表(数据表中的字段)
create table t_student(sno int(6), -- 6:显示长度sname varchar(10), -- 10:10个字符sex char(1),age int(3),enterdate date,classname varchar(10),email varchar(15)
鼠标选中sql语句,鼠标右键,执行选中的代码,数据库表就生成了
4、查看表结构
查看表结构:desc 数据表
desc t_student;
5、查看表中的数据
查看表中的所有信息:select * from 数据表名
select * from t_student;
6、查看建表语句
查看建表语句:show create table 数据库表
show create table t_student
7、注释
单行注释:两个#号开头,或者-- 开头
多行注释:
/*
多行注释
多行注释
多行注释
*/
MySQL—创建数据表相关推荐
- MySQL 创建数据表
MySQL 创建数据表 创建MySQL数据表的SQL语法: CREATE TABLE table_name (column_name column_type); 例如,我们在 PENGKE 数据库中创 ...
- mysql创建表设置数值范围,MySQL创建数据表时设定引擎MyISAM/InnoDB操作
我在配置mysql时将配置文件中的默认存储引擎设定为了innodb.今天查看了myisam与innodb的区别,在该文中的第七条"myisam支持gis数据,innodb不支持.即myisa ...
- mysql创建数据表列子,MySQL 创建数据库及简单增删改查
MySQL 创建数据库及简单增删改查 我们可以在登陆 MySQL 服务后,使用 create 命令创建数据库,语法如下: CREATE DATABASE 数据库名; 登入: Enter passwor ...
- 数据库系统原理与应用教程(023)—— MySQL 创建数据表的各种方法总结
数据库系统原理与应用教程(023)-- MySQL 创建数据表的各种方法总结 目录 数据库系统原理与应用教程(023)-- MySQL 创建数据表的各种方法总结 一.使用 create table 命 ...
- navicat mysql 建表语句_Navicat for MySQL怎么/如何创建数据表?Navicat for MySQL创建数据表教程_斗蟹游戏网...
[斗蟹攻略]Navicat for MySQL是针对MySQL数据库管理而研发的管理工具,创建数据表是其最基本操作,下面就由斗蟹小编介绍Navicat for MySQL创建数据表的方法. Navic ...
- MySQL创建数据表(CREATE TABLE语句)
在创建数据库之后,接下来就要在数据库中创建数据表.所谓创建数据表,指的是在已经创建的数据库中建立新表. 创建数据表的过程是规定数据列的属性的过程,同时也是实施数据完整性(包括实体完整性.引用完整性和域 ...
- 第10章 MySQL 创建数据表教程
创建MySQL数据表需要以下信息: 表名 表字段名 定义每个表字段 语法 以下为创建MySQL数据表的SQL通用语法: CREATE TABLE table_name (column_name col ...
- MySQL学习之路(八):MySQL创建数据表
CREATE TABLE语句 在创建数据库之后,接下来就要在数据库中创建数据表.所谓创建数据表,指的是在已经创建的数据库中建立新表. 创建数据表的过程是规定数据列的属性的过程,同时也是实施数据完整性( ...
- 【MySQL 创建数据表,并添加数据】
MySQL 中创建数据表,并添加数据 1. 创建表 create table test_table( ID int, Ename varchar(255), job varchar(255), job ...
- MySQL创建数据表时设定引擎MyISAM/InnoDB
我在配置mysql时将配置文件中的默认存储引擎设定为了InnoDB.今天查看了MyISAM与InnoDB的区别,在该文中的第七条"MyISAM支持GIS数据,InnoDB不支持.即MyISA ...
最新文章
- vlc延时处理-跳帧
- 2019第十届蓝桥杯比赛总结(B组c/c++)
- TCP/IP / PDU 是什么
- linux生成驱动编译的头文件,嵌入式Linux字符设备驱动——5生成字符设备节点
- 联想服务器开启虚拟化,联想电脑虚拟化开启方法
- php pdo 00000,php-即使有错误,PDO错误代码也总是00000
- 2.4 线性相关和张成空间
- 再说共识性算法Raft
- canvas绘制渐变
- nyoj 56 阶乘中素数的个数
- TYVJ1467 通往聚会的道路
- java 继承 this_java多重继承的this属于谁
- 生活是艰难的,我又划着我的断桨出发了
- 【HUSTOJ】1047: 字符图形3-平行四边形
- IEEE检验格式出现字体嵌入问题
- powershell激活conda失败;无法加载文件 C:\Users\user\Documents\WindowsPowerShell\profile.ps1,因为在此系统上禁止运行脚本
- 书单来了!大厂的技术牛人在读什么:阿里篇
- 树莓派4b和3b+功耗_ARM v8(树莓派4)搭建服务器和性能测试实战
- 【SequoiaDB巨杉数据库】Oma-stopAllNodes
- MHCHXM超快恢复二极管SF1604为什么是三个脚
热门文章
- 中科大微型计算机原理,中科大微机原理试题.pdf
- java在网页填写集数据,java网页数据采集(中篇-数据存储)
- python粘贴代码到word_Python复制Word内容并使用格式设字体与大小实例代码
- 国家发改委:分两批在8个地区建设全国一体化算力网络国家枢纽节点
- 城市中的像素灯塔-前海数据中心,深圳
- python匿名函数调用_python3笔记十六:python匿名函数和高阶函数
- CV:cv2实现检测几何形状并进行识别、输出周长、面积、颜色、形状类型
- 成功解决 利用plt.plot绘图时,横坐标出现浮点小数而不是整数的情况(坐标轴刻度)
- ML之SVM:基于SVM(支持向量机)之SVC算法对手写数字图片识别进行预测
- MAT之GRNN/PNN:基于GRNN、PNN两神经网络实现并比较鸢尾花(iris数据集)种类识别正确率、各个模型运行时间对比